A Spellbinding New Fairytale: 100 Nights of Hero Brings Isabel Greenberg’s Graphic Novel to the Big Screen
A dazzling new cinematic fable arrives with 100 Nights of Hero, a visually sumptuous and emotionally resonant adaptation of Isabel Greenberg’s award‑winning graphic novel. Inspired in spirit by the ancient tales of Arabian Nights, the film reimagines storytelling itself as an act of rebellion, resilience, and sisterhood.
Set in a richly stylised world where myth and modernity intertwine, the story follows Cherry, a noble young maiden who enters into marriage with the aloof and self‑absorbed Jerome. Bound by a contract demanding an heir, Cherry soon finds herself abandoned when Jerome departs and leaves her in the company of his charismatic but predatory friend, Manfred — a man determined to win a cruel bet by seducing her.
To protect Cherry from loneliness and danger, her devoted maid Hero begins to weave a tapestry of stories: tales of bold, defiant women who have outwitted the men who sought to control them. Across one hundred nights, Hero’s storytelling becomes both shield and subversion, transforming the act of narration into a powerful force of liberation.
